Tip 1: Conduct Pre-Visit Research: Before visiting the store, research available product lines and desired features online. Identify specific brands, models, and technologies that align with individual needs and preferences. This pre-emptive approach reduces the time spent browsing and enables more focused inquiries with sales associates.
Tip 2: Assess Footwear Needs Accurately: Understand foot type (e.g., pronation, supination, neutral) and intended activity. Improper footwear selection can lead to discomfort, injury, and reduced athletic performance. Consider professional gait analysis if needed to determine the most suitable shoe type.
Tip 3: Inquire About Staff Expertise: Engage with sales associates and inquire about their knowledge of product features, benefits, and sizing recommendations. A knowledgeable staff can provide valuable insights and assist in identifying the most appropriate options for specific needs.
Tip 4: Prioritize Fit Over Aesthetics: While visual appeal is a factor, prioritize proper fit and comfort. Ill-fitting shoes can cause blisters, calluses, and other foot problems. Ensure adequate toe room and a secure heel fit. Test shoes by walking or jogging within the store.
Tip 5: Consider Seasonal Sales and Promotions: Retailers often offer discounted pricing during seasonal sales events or promotional periods. Subscribe to email newsletters or follow social media accounts to stay informed about upcoming deals. Strategic timing of purchases can result in significant cost savings.
Tip 6: Review Return Policies: Before finalizing a purchase, thoroughly review the store’s return policy. Understand the conditions under which returns or exchanges are permitted, including timeframes, required documentation, and any associated fees. This safeguard protects against dissatisfaction with the product.

1. Product Availability
Product availability, in the context of a retail establishment such as “finish line wichita ks”, represents the extent to which desired merchandise is readily accessible to consumers at a given point in time. This factor directly influences customer satisfaction, sales volume, and overall business performance.
- Inventory Management Efficiency
Efficient inventory management is crucial for ensuring consistent product availability. This involves accurately forecasting demand, maintaining optimal stock levels, and minimizing stockouts or overstock situations. For example, failing to stock popular shoe sizes or colorways can lead to lost sales and customer frustration. Effective inventory control systems and data analysis are essential for optimizing product availability.
- Supply Chain Reliability
The reliability of the supply chain significantly impacts the consistent flow of merchandise. Disruptions in the supply chain, such as delays in shipping, manufacturing bottlenecks, or geopolitical events, can lead to product shortages and reduced availability. Maintaining strong relationships with suppliers and diversifying sourcing options can mitigate these risks. “finish line wichita ks” would need reliable sources to keep products.
- Seasonal Demand Fluctuations
Demand for athletic footwear and apparel often fluctuates seasonally, with peaks during back-to-school periods, holidays, and specific sporting events. Retailers must anticipate these fluctuations and adjust their inventory levels accordingly. For instance, stocking more running shoes leading up to a local marathon or increasing inventory of basketball shoes during the NBA season are examples of adapting to seasonal demand.
- Competitive Landscape and Exclusivity
The competitive landscape and the availability of exclusive products can also influence product availability. If a competitor offers a similar product at a lower price or has exclusive rights to a particular brand or model, it can impact the demand and availability of products at “finish line wichita ks”. Securing exclusive partnerships with key brands or offering unique product variations can enhance competitiveness.
These facets illustrate that product availability is not simply a matter of having products on shelves. It is a complex interplay of inventory management, supply chain dynamics, seasonal demand, and competitive pressures. Addressing these factors effectively is critical for any athletic retail store striving to meet customer needs and maintain a competitive edge. It also keeps local customers happy.

Question 1: What factors contribute to the determination of product pricing at “finish line wichita ks”?
Product pricing is influenced by a combination of factors, including manufacturer’s suggested retail price (MSRP), wholesale acquisition costs, competitor pricing strategies, and prevailing market demand. Promotional discounts and seasonal sales may also impact pricing at any given time. Inventory holding costs and anticipated markdowns further contribute to final pricing decisions.
